What Is a Travel CPAP?
A travel CPAP is a smaller, more portable version of a traditional CPAP machine. These units are designed specifically for people who want to continue their sleep therapy while traveling without carrying their full-size setup.
Travel CPAP machines are often:
- Smaller and lighter than standard CPAP machines
- Easy to pack in a carry-on bag
- FAA-compliant for air travel
- Compatible with battery options for camping or power outages
- Designed for quick setup and portability
While travel CPAP machines offer many conveniences, they’re not intended to completely replace a primary home unit for everyone. Many users choose to keep their standard machine at home and purchase a travel CPAP for vacations, business trips, weekends away, and outdoor adventures.
Why Consider a Travel CPAP?
Skipping CPAP therapy while traveling can quickly undo the benefits you’ve worked hard to achieve.
Even a few nights without treatment may lead to:
- Poor sleep quality
- Daytime fatigue
- Increased snoring
- Morning headaches
- Difficulty concentrating
A travel CPAP makes it easier to maintain your therapy routine no matter where you are.
For frequent travelers, the convenience of having a dedicated travel machine often means less hassle packing, fewer concerns about damaging their primary machine, and greater confidence when planning trips.
Popular Travel CPAP Features
Today’s travel CPAP machines offer impressive technology despite their smaller size.
Depending on the model, features may include:
Compact Design
Many travel units weigh only a few pounds and take up significantly less space in luggage than traditional machines.
Battery Compatibility
For camping, RV travel, or locations where power access is limited, many travel CPAPs can connect to external battery systems.
Smartphone Connectivity
Some models, including the ResMed AirMini travel CPAP carried by HME Home Medical, allow users to monitor therapy data and adjust settings through companion apps.
Automatic Pressure Adjustments
Many travel units include Auto CPAP functionality that adjusts pressure throughout the night based on your breathing patterns.
Universal Power Options
International travelers often appreciate flexible power supplies that work with various voltage standards around the world. Note: Physical plug adapters are not included with the machine and need to be purchased separately for your destination.
CPAP Comfort Accessories Worth Considering
While insurance typically covers medically necessary CPAP equipment and replacement supplies, many comfort-enhancing accessories are considered convenience items and must be purchased out of pocket.
For many users, these small additions can make a surprisingly big difference.
CPAP Strap Covers
Mask headgear can sometimes cause irritation, pressure marks, or discomfort around the cheeks and neck.
Soft strap covers provide extra cushioning between your skin and the headgear, helping reduce irritation and improve comfort during sleep.
PAP Hose Wrap
A heat-retaining cover for your PAP tubing helps to keep your tubing warm and smooth, preventing snags on bedding.
For those who share their homes with curious pets, this wrap can also help protect tubing from wandering paws and claws.
PAP Mask Liners
Some CPAP users, specifically those who use a full face or nasal mask, complain about the red marks and lines that remain on their faces even after they’ve removed their mask and started their day. While these marks are a hallmark of a tight, proper seal, mask liners can help.
Available in disposable and reusable versions, mask liners improve hygiene while helping to reduce leaks, skin irritation, and red marks.
CPAP Pillows
Specially designed CPAP pillows feature cutouts that accommodate masks and tubing, helping reduce mask leaks and pressure points while sleeping on your side.
Portable Outlet Rechargeable Battery
When travel plans leave you without a steady source of electricity, having a backup plan is essential.
Portable, rechargeable battery packs can provide power to any PAP unit for 7-9 hours on a full charge (without humidifier) allowing you to sleep confidently.
Are Travel CPAPs and Accessories Covered by Insurance?
In most cases, travel CPAP machines, comfort accessories, cleaning wipes, tubing covers, and similar convenience products are not covered by insurance.
Insurance plans, including Medicare, typically focus on medically necessary equipment and replacement supplies required for therapy.
Because coverage varies, it’s always a good idea to check with your insurance provider regarding your specific benefits. Patients who have Medicare Advantage plans should ask their agent or plan provider about any “flex cards” or allowances that may cover these items.
Even when these products are not covered, many users find the convenience and comfort benefits well worth the investment.
